[Pkg-cli-libs-commits] r4434 - in /packages/taoframework/trunk/debian: changelog control libtaoframework-ode0.9-cil.install libtaoframework-opengl3.0-cil.install libtaoframework-sdl1.2-cil.install rules
laney at users.alioth.debian.org
laney at users.alioth.debian.org
Tue Jun 7 15:53:29 UTC 2011
Author: laney
Date: Tue Jun 7 15:53:29 2011
New Revision: 4434
URL: http://svn.debian.org/wsvn/pkg-cli-libs/?sc=1&rev=4434
Log:
Packaging and 2.10 cleanups
Still wants DH7ing
Modified:
packages/taoframework/trunk/debian/changelog
packages/taoframework/trunk/debian/control
packages/taoframework/trunk/debian/libtaoframework-ode0.9-cil.install
packages/taoframework/trunk/debian/libtaoframework-opengl3.0-cil.install
packages/taoframework/trunk/debian/libtaoframework-sdl1.2-cil.install
packages/taoframework/trunk/debian/rules
Modified: packages/taoframework/trunk/debian/changelog
URL: http://svn.debian.org/wsvn/pkg-cli-libs/packages/taoframework/trunk/debian/changelog?rev=4434&op=diff
==============================================================================
--- packages/taoframework/trunk/debian/changelog (original)
+++ packages/taoframework/trunk/debian/changelog Tue Jun 7 15:53:29 2011
@@ -1,3 +1,16 @@
+taoframework (2.1.svn20090801-5) UNRELEASED; urgency=low
+
+ * debian/control:
+ + Remove some obsolete BDs
+ + Use dh_prep instead of dh_clean
+ + Standards-Version â 3.9.2, no changes required
+ * debian/rules:
+ + Use the system default gacutil instead of hardcoding gacutil2
+ + Use dh_prep instead of dh_clean
+ * Run wrap-and-sort
+
+ -- Iain Lane <laney at debian.org> Mon, 06 Jun 2011 22:17:46 +0100
+
taoframework (2.1.svn20090801-4) unstable; urgency=low
* d/control:
Modified: packages/taoframework/trunk/debian/control
URL: http://svn.debian.org/wsvn/pkg-cli-libs/packages/taoframework/trunk/debian/control?rev=4434&op=diff
==============================================================================
--- packages/taoframework/trunk/debian/control (original)
+++ packages/taoframework/trunk/debian/control Tue Jun 7 15:53:29 2011
@@ -2,9 +2,35 @@
Section: cli-mono
Priority: optional
Maintainer: Debian CLI Libraries Team <pkg-cli-libs-team at lists.alioth.debian.org>
-Uploaders: Sebastian Dröge <slomo at debian.org>, Dylan R. E. Moonfire <debian at mfgames.com>, Sam Hocevar <sho at debian.org>
+Uploaders: Sebastian Dröge <slomo at debian.org>,
+ Dylan R. E. Moonfire <debian at mfgames.com>,
+ Sam Hocevar <sho at debian.org>
Build-Depends: debhelper (>= 5), quilt
-Build-Depends-Indep: cli-common-dev (>= 0.4.4), mono-gac, mono-devel (>= 2.4.3), mono-utils, libmono-dev, libopenal-dev, libsdl-image1.2-dev, libsdl-mixer1.2-dev, libsdl-net1.2-dev, libsdl-ttf2.0-dev, libsdl-gfx1.2-dev, libsdl1.2-dev, libsmpeg-dev, libode-dev, libdevil-dev, libphysfs-dev, freeglut3-dev, libglu1-mesa-dev | libglu1-dev, libgl1-mesa-dev | libgl1-dev, monodoc-base, liblua5.1-0-dev, libavcodec-dev (>= 3:0.svn20090303), libavformat-dev (>= 3:0.svn20090303), libswscale-dev, libnunit-cil-dev, libftgl-dev, libfreetype6-dev, libalut-dev
+Build-Depends-Indep: cli-common-dev (>= 0.4.4),
+ freeglut3-dev,
+ libalut-dev,
+ libavcodec-dev (>= 3:0.svn20090303),
+ libavformat-dev (>= 3:0.svn20090303),
+ libdevil-dev,
+ libfreetype6-dev,
+ libftgl-dev,
+ libgl1-mesa-dev | libgl1-dev,
+ libglu1-mesa-dev | libglu1-dev,
+ liblua5.1-0-dev,
+ libnunit-cil-dev,
+ libode-dev,
+ libopenal-dev,
+ libphysfs-dev,
+ libsdl-gfx1.2-dev,
+ libsdl-image1.2-dev,
+ libsdl-mixer1.2-dev,
+ libsdl-net1.2-dev,
+ libsdl-ttf2.0-dev,
+ libsdl1.2-dev,
+ libsmpeg-dev,
+ libswscale-dev,
+ mono-devel (>= 2.4.3),
+ monodoc-base
Standards-Version: 3.9.1
Vcs-Svn: svn://svn.debian.org/svn/pkg-cli-libs/packages/taoframework/trunk
Vcs-Browser: http://svn.debian.org/wsvn/pkg-cli-libs/packages/taoframework/trunk?op=log
@@ -41,7 +67,8 @@
Architecture: all
Depends: libtaoframework-opengl3.0-cil (= ${binary:Version}), ${misc:Depends}
Conflicts: libtaoframework-opengl2.1-cil
-Replaces: libtaoframework-opengl2.1-cil, libtaoframework-opengl3.0-cil (<< 2.1.svn20090801-2~)
+Replaces: libtaoframework-opengl2.1-cil,
+ libtaoframework-opengl3.0-cil (<< 2.1.svn20090801-2~)
Description: Tao CLI binding for OpenGL and GLU - development files
The Tao Framework is a collection of bindings and libraries to
facilitate cross-platform games-related development utilizing the Mono
@@ -143,7 +170,8 @@
Architecture: all
Depends: libtaoframework-ode0.9-cil (= ${binary:Version}), ${misc:Depends}
Conflicts: libtaoframework-ode0.6-cil
-Replaces: libtaoframework-ode0.6-cil, libtaoframework-ode0.9-cil (<< 2.1.svn20090801-2~)
+Replaces: libtaoframework-ode0.6-cil,
+ libtaoframework-ode0.9-cil (<< 2.1.svn20090801-2~)
Description: Tao CLI binding for ODE - development files
The Tao Framework is a collection of bindings and libraries to
facilitate cross-platform games-related development utilizing the Mono
@@ -202,8 +230,8 @@
Package: libtaoframework-freeglut-cil-dev
Architecture: all
Depends: libtaoframework-freeglut2.4-cil (= ${binary:Version}),
- libtaoframework-opengl-cil-dev,
- ${misc:Depends}
+ libtaoframework-opengl-cil-dev,
+ ${misc:Depends}
Replaces: libtaoframework-freeglut2.4-cil (<< 2.1.svn20090801-2~)
Description: Tao CLI binding for freeglut - development files
The Tao Framework is a collection of bindings and libraries to
@@ -364,4 +392,3 @@
implementation.
.
This package contains the compiled XML documentation for Tao.
-
Modified: packages/taoframework/trunk/debian/libtaoframework-ode0.9-cil.install
URL: http://svn.debian.org/wsvn/pkg-cli-libs/packages/taoframework/trunk/debian/libtaoframework-ode0.9-cil.install?rev=4434&op=diff
==============================================================================
--- packages/taoframework/trunk/debian/libtaoframework-ode0.9-cil.install (original)
+++ packages/taoframework/trunk/debian/libtaoframework-ode0.9-cil.install Tue Jun 7 15:53:29 2011
@@ -1,2 +1,2 @@
+/usr/lib/mono/gac/Tao.Ode.Tests/*/* /usr/lib/cli/Tao.Ode.Tests-1.0/
/usr/lib/mono/gac/Tao.Ode/*/* /usr/lib/cli/Tao.Ode-0.9/
-/usr/lib/mono/gac/Tao.Ode.Tests/*/* /usr/lib/cli/Tao.Ode.Tests-1.0/
Modified: packages/taoframework/trunk/debian/libtaoframework-opengl3.0-cil.install
URL: http://svn.debian.org/wsvn/pkg-cli-libs/packages/taoframework/trunk/debian/libtaoframework-opengl3.0-cil.install?rev=4434&op=diff
==============================================================================
--- packages/taoframework/trunk/debian/libtaoframework-opengl3.0-cil.install (original)
+++ packages/taoframework/trunk/debian/libtaoframework-opengl3.0-cil.install Tue Jun 7 15:53:29 2011
@@ -1,3 +1,3 @@
/usr/lib/mono/gac/Tao.OpenGl/*/* /usr/lib/cli/Tao.OpenGl-3.0/
+/usr/lib/mono/gac/Tao.Platform.Windows/*/* /usr/lib/cli/Tao.Platform.Windows-1.0/
/usr/lib/mono/gac/Tao.Platform.X11/*/* /usr/lib/cli/Tao.Platform.X11-1.0/
-/usr/lib/mono/gac/Tao.Platform.Windows/*/* /usr/lib/cli/Tao.Platform.Windows-1.0/
Modified: packages/taoframework/trunk/debian/libtaoframework-sdl1.2-cil.install
URL: http://svn.debian.org/wsvn/pkg-cli-libs/packages/taoframework/trunk/debian/libtaoframework-sdl1.2-cil.install?rev=4434&op=diff
==============================================================================
--- packages/taoframework/trunk/debian/libtaoframework-sdl1.2-cil.install (original)
+++ packages/taoframework/trunk/debian/libtaoframework-sdl1.2-cil.install Tue Jun 7 15:53:29 2011
@@ -1,2 +1,2 @@
+/usr/lib/mono/gac/Tao.Sdl.Tests/*/* /usr/lib/cli/Tao.Sdl.Tests-1.0/
/usr/lib/mono/gac/Tao.Sdl/*/* /usr/lib/cli/Tao.Sdl-1.2/
-/usr/lib/mono/gac/Tao.Sdl.Tests/*/* /usr/lib/cli/Tao.Sdl.Tests-1.0/
Modified: packages/taoframework/trunk/debian/rules
URL: http://svn.debian.org/wsvn/pkg-cli-libs/packages/taoframework/trunk/debian/rules?rev=4434&op=diff
==============================================================================
--- packages/taoframework/trunk/debian/rules (original)
+++ packages/taoframework/trunk/debian/rules Tue Jun 7 15:53:29 2011
@@ -11,7 +11,7 @@
configure-stamp:
dh_testdir
QUILT_PATCHES=debian/patches quilt push -a || test $$? = 2
- CSC=/usr/bin/mono-csc ./configure --prefix=/usr
+ GACUTIL=/usr/bin/gacutil CSC=/usr/bin/mono-csc ./configure --prefix=/usr
touch configure-stamp
build: build-stamp
@@ -50,7 +50,7 @@
install: build
dh_testdir
dh_testroot
- dh_clean -k
+ dh_prep
$(MAKE) install DESTDIR=$$(pwd)/debian/tmp
# Copy examples contents, then clean up unwanted files
@@ -95,7 +95,7 @@
dh_fixperms
dh_installdeb
dh_makeclilibs -m $(UPVERSION) -l $(NEXT_UPVERSION)
- dh_clideps -d
+ dh_clideps -d --exclude-moduleref=libdl.dylib --exclude-moduleref=/System/Library/Frameworks/Cocoa.framework/Cocoa --exclude-moduleref=libobjc.dylib
dh_gencontrol
dh_md5sums
dh_builddeb
More information about the Pkg-cli-libs-commits
mailing list